SimilarWeb

Description: SimilarWeb is a website analytics platform that provides insights into any website's traffic sources, referring sites, keywords, and more. It offers competitors analysis, industry benchmarking, and market intelligence to optimize digital marketing and strategic planning.

Buzzsumo

Description: BuzzSumo is a content marketing and social media analytics tool that allows users to analyze the performance of content across social networks. It provides insights into which content performs best, who is sharing content, and what topics resonate with target audiences.
